How would you plan the development of a service that handles a large number of similar resource-intensive tasks?

To develop a service that handles a large number of similar resource-intensive tasks, it is important to plan the architecture considering scalability and resilience.

Main approaches:

  • Task queues and asynchronous processing: use message queues (e.g., RabbitMQ, Kafka) to distribute tasks among workers. This allows controlling the load and processing tasks in parallel.

  • Thread or worker pool: implement a thread pool to limit the number of tasks executed simultaneously and avoid resource exhaustion.

  • Scaling: provide for horizontal scaling of the service so that when the load increases, additional instances can be launched.

  • Monitoring and logging: set up metrics collection and logs to track performance and identify bottlenecks.

Example in Java using ExecutorService:

ExecutorService executor = Executors.newFixedThreadPool(10); // pool of 10 threads

for (Task task : tasks) {
    executor.submit(() -> {
        // resource-intensive task processing
        process(task);
    });
}

executor.shutdown();
